Typing Simulator Brings Learning to Life
Typing Simulator is an engaging typing game designed specifically for those looking to improve their typing skills on PC. Distinct from other typing applications, it allows players to learn effectively while having fun. This journey began when the developers realized existing tools fell short of their learning goals, prompting them to create a comprehensive yet enjoyable typing experience.
Tailored Learning with Frequency Analysis
At the core of Typing Simulator is its innovative approach to learning. The game utilizes word and letter frequency analysis to craft a personalized curriculum aimed at enhancing your touch typing abilities. As you practice, the system tracks your performance locally, ensuring that each session adapts to your skills. This means that progress isn't just measured in speed, but also in accuracy and technique.
Beyond Speed: Metrics that Matter
Typing isn't just about how fast you can press keys; it's also about doing so accurately. The game features a Speed Test that measures your progress, but it goes further by tracking a variety of other metrics. This includes error reduction and consistency, key components in avoiding bad habits that may lead to repetitive stress injuries. Players can see how they stack up against friends, adding a layer of competition that keeps motivation high.
Create and Share with Custom Keyboards
One of the standout features of Typing Simulator is its support for user-generated content. Building custom keyboards can be cumbersome, but this game simplifies the process. Players can easily design and construct their own keyboards, allowing for a personalized experience that enhances gameplay. Sharing these creations with the community fosters collaboration and enriches the typing adventure.
Engage in Fun Game Modes for Effective Practice
Repetitive drills can dull the enthusiasm for learning, but Typing Simulator offers a variety of game modes that combine practice with enjoyment. Narrative Mode, for instance, blends competitive typing challenges with speed-running, making each session exciting. The 1k and 5k Challenges push players to achieve the fastest cumulative times on the most commonly used words, driving competitive spirit and engagement.
A Distraction-Free Writing Environment
When focusing on improving typing skills, the right environment is crucial. Typing Simulator features a distraction-free writing mode, creating an ideal space for players to concentrate. With controlled visual and audio stimuli, this mode cultivates an atmosphere perfect for creative writing and ideas flow. It’s not just about typing—it’s about crafting your thoughts without interruptions.
Join the Typing Community and Compete
In Typing Simulator, competition extends beyond performance metrics. The game integrates community elements, allowing players to compare scores on leaderboards and challenge friends. This adds a social dimension to the learning experience. The emphasis on fun game modes ensures that players stay engaged, continuing to hone their skills in a supportive yet competitive environment.

What platforms is Typing Simulator on?
Typing Simulator is available on PC.
When was Typing Simulator released?
Typing Simulator was released on May 21, 2025.
